Kirk Johnson is senior vice president,
Global Operations, responsible for the company’s operations in Alaska, Asia
Pacific, Canada, Europe, Middle East & Africa.
Kirk has more than 25 years of oil and
natural gas experience. He previously served in leadership roles as senior vice
president, Lower 48 Assets and Operations; vice president, Corporate Planning
and Development, accountable for corporate planning, strategy development, and
investment appraisal and assurance; and president, Canada, overseeing the
Surmont oil sands operation and the Montney unconventional play.
He began his career with BP in 1997 and
worked in a variety of engineering, operations, and project positions
supporting oil and gas operations in Alaska. Kirk joined ConocoPhillips in 2008
and held increasingly accountable roles in asset management and corporate
planning.
Externally, Kirk serves on the board of
directors of Coastal Prairie Conservancy. Previously, he served as a member of
the board of governors for Education Matters, Calgary’s trust for public
education.
He earned a Bachelor of Science in chemical
engineering and petroleum refining from Colorado School of Mines in 1997.
